In the Ace Attorney games, players often have to look for hidden hints and clues. And now, as its anime is getting a second season, it looks like they’re doing the same with the new key visual. The visual is pretty simple, with the upper side featuring Phoenix Wright, while the other features antagonist Godot.

So, have you seen the hidden message? After all, they left a pretty huge clue on how to get it, and it’s colored yellow. Here’s a hint if you still haven’t guessed; turn the photo upside down.

Have you seen it? The hidden message should be the upside down of Ace Attorney’s Japanese title, Gyakuten Saiban. In fact, its the inverted version of the work “Gyakuten” or 逆転 which means “turn-about”. The upside down version reads “Shouri” (勝利 or “victory”). What could this mean? The staff also confirmed that the anime will premiere on 6th October via YTV and NTV. It will be replacing the current season of My Hero Academia for the 5:30 pm JST timeslot. The fist season’s main cast will also be returning for this second season as well:

  • Yuuki Kaji as Phoenix Wright/Ryuuichi Naruhodou
  • Aoi Yuuki as Maya Fey/Mayoi Ayasato
  • Masashi Tamaki as Miles Edgeworth/Reiji Mitsurugi
  • Chie Nakamura as Mia Fey/Chihiro Ayasato
  • Masami Iwasaki as Dick Gumshoe/Keisuke Itonokogiri
  • Tooru Nara as Larry Butz/Masashi Yahari

A-1 Pictures will once again be producing the anime, with Season 1’s director, Ayumu Watanabe, also making his return. Other staff members such as series writer Atsuhiro Tomioka, composer Kaoru Wada, and character designer Keiko Oota are also returning.
